Transaction f51a589cb1cb49aa016beaadb7b0c6a82145a93a12a44117fb3313391ed5c771
1 Input
1 Output
-
f51a589cb1cb49aa016beaadb7b0c6a82145a93a12a44117fb3313391ed5c771:0
- value
- 26808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0791f6bf60d1af1ca701b68962c865cff34f4ce OP_EQUAL
- address
- 3LhKaCZHxi8ooYuLz3HQNmm1M68vvZ8sCX